@mrFrip
Преодолеваю прокрастинацию

Разработка под Android на C#?

Здравствуйте.

Слабо разбираюсь в этом вопросе, из-за этого могу неверно трактовать некоторые понятия, прошу прощения.

Имеет ли весомым аргументом разрабатывать приложения (в т.ч. игры на том же самом unity) именно на C#, а не на Java.
Есть ли какие-нибудь весомые преимущества и недостатки перед Java.
  • Вопрос задан
  • 580 просмотров
Пригласить эксперта
Ответы на вопрос 2
mindtester
@mindtester
делаю странные вещи, обычно на C#
если вы отлично знаете C# + отлично знаете Xamarin = это очень весомый аргумент

но если планируете начать... - в java вы будете собирать грабли java и android... а в xamarin ++ грабли xamarin

ps

Unity сам по себе, и сам в себе C#

вы уж определитесь сами... есть люди пишущие на многих языках.. можно оба языка осваивать, можно и один. но в любом случае, разработка для андроида - это кросс-разработка. легко не будет. и как всегда, что бы начать - надо начать
Ответ написан
LemonRX
@LemonRX
Начинающий Android разработчик
Если вы конкретно хотите разрабатывать приложения а не игры, то все же рекомендую сделать выбор в сторону java или kotlin по следующим причинам:
1) java является родным языком для андроид
2) примеры, уроки все на java
3) в целом сообщество использует java
4) студия заточена под java

Если вы хотите разрабатывать игры на юнити то у вас нет выбора между java и c# так как юнити не поддерживает java
Ответ написан
Ваш ответ на вопрос

Войдите, чтобы написать ответ

Войти через TM ID
Похожие вопросы